What Is a Bail Bond?



A bail bond functions as an economic warranty that ensures a defendant's appearance in court after being launched from safekeeping. This legal tool makes it possible for individuals who have been arrested to protect their momentary flexibility while waiting for trial. By publishing a bail bond, the defendant offers the court with a guarantee that they will return for all scheduled hearings.


Generally, bail bonds are provided by certified bail bond representatives or firms, who bill a non-refundable fee, normally a portion of the overall bail quantity. This cost makes up the bail agent for the threat they assume in assuring the offender's appearance. If the defendant falls short to show up in court, the bail bond becomes waived, and the bail agent is accountable for ensuring the defendant's go back to deal with the charges.

Exactly How Bail Bonds Work

Comprehending exactly how bail bonds job is essential for navigating the lawful system properly. A bail bond is a legal contract in between a bond bondsman, the accused, and the court. When an individual is apprehended, a court establishes a bail quantity based upon the severity of the criminal activity and the individual's trip danger. If the accused can not afford this amount, they might look for the solutions of a bond bondsman.


The bail bondsman usually charges a non-refundable charge, normally around 10% of the total bail quantity, in exchange for uploading the bail in support of the accused. This cost is the bondsman's compensation for the threat they take by assuring the court that the accused will show up for future court dates.




When the bail is posted, the defendant is launched from custodianship, but they stay required to adhere to the conditions established by the court. If the defendant stops working to appear for their arranged court dates, the bail bondsman might look for to recover the full bail quantity from the accused or their co-signer.
